What is your typical process for working with a new customer?
My process for working with new customers is to listen to what they want and for what purpose. During the photography session, I work with customers to capture the best possible photos. As we work, I show customers their photos on my camera or laptop to make sure we are on track to capturing the photos they need. Afterwards, I do some minor editing before sending all images to customers for digital download.
